As far as the PDK goes, everyone likes it. Even hard core shifters say the PDK is great, they still love stick but it is hard to knock at this point. F-cars are no longer being designed with gated shifters, they will all be double clutch from here on out. So its not like this is a fad that is going away.

Having spent over 3 hours in stop-n-go traffic last weekend, I wished I was in a PDK for the first time since I got the car. Thankfully that is not a common occurrence for me. I can only imagine what traffic in Taiwan is like. You need to test drive a PDK and see how it feels for you, then go from there.
Just be sure to put it in manual mode so you can get the full experience.
